本文对26例缺氧缺血性脑病(HIE)新生儿和28例健康新生儿(对照组)静脉血清肌酸激酶(CK)、乳酸脱氢酶(LDH)、谷草转氨酶(GOT)、α-羟丁酸脱氢酶(α-HBDH)于生后3天内进行检测并做心电图以观察HIE新生儿心脏受损的情况。结果表明,血清CK、LDH、GOT、α-HBDH水平HIE组明显高于对照组(p<0.01),重度HIE组显著高于中度HIE组(p<0.01),中度HIE组高于轻度HIE组(p<0.01)。HIE组异常心电图百分率高于正常对照组,但无统计学差异(p>0.05)。提示HIE新生儿生后早拥有血清心肌酶活性和心电图的异常改变,似可作为临床早期初步筛查HIE新生儿心脏受损及估价其严重程度的指标。
In this study, 26 neonates with hypoxic-ischemic encephalopathy (HIE) and 28 healthy newborns (control group) received serum creatine kinase (CK), lactate dehydrogenase (LDH), aspartate aminotransferase (GOT) Hydroxybutyrate dehydrogenase (α-HBDH) was detected within 3 days after birth and ECG to observe HIE neonatal heart damage. The results showed that serum CK, LDH, GOT and α-HBDH levels in HIE group were significantly higher than those in control group (p <0.01), severe HIE group was significantly higher than that in moderate HIE group (p <0.01) Group was higher than mild HIE group (p <0.01). The percentage of abnormal ECG in HIE group was higher than that in normal control group, but there was no significant difference (p> 0.05). HIE neonatal neonatal early with serum myocardial enzyme activity and ECG abnormalities may be used as a preliminary clinical early neonatal HIE heart damage and assess the severity of indicators.
